Introduction

Dysautonomia is a complex medical condition that affects the autonomic nervous system (ANS) and poses unique challenges for aging individuals. The ANS is responsible for controlling many important bodily functions that occur automatically, without conscious effort. These functions include regulating heart rate, blood pressure, digestion, and breathing. When someone has dysautonomia, their ANS doesn’t work properly, which can lead to a wide range of symptoms and complications.

As people get older, the effects of dysautonomia can become more pronounced and challenging to manage. This is because the aging process itself can impact the functioning of the autonomic nervous system, potentially worsening existing dysautonomia symptoms or making new ones appear. Understanding how dysautonomia affects older adults is crucial for providing appropriate care and support.

There are several different types of dysautonomia, each with its own set of symptoms and challenges. Some common forms include Postural Orthostatic Tachycardia Syndrome (POTS), Neurocardiogenic Syncope, and Multiple System Atrophy. These conditions can vary in severity and impact on daily life, especially for aging individuals.

The causes of dysautonomia can be diverse and sometimes difficult to pinpoint. In some cases, it may be a primary condition, meaning it occurs on its own. In other instances, it can be secondary to another medical condition, such as diabetes, Parkinson’s disease, or certain autoimmune disorders. Understanding the underlying cause is important for developing an effective treatment plan.

For older adults living with dysautonomia, there are unique challenges and considerations that need to be addressed. These may include managing multiple medications, dealing with increased fall risk, and adapting to lifestyle changes. Additionally, the symptoms of dysautonomia can sometimes be mistaken for normal signs of aging, leading to delayed diagnosis and treatment.

As we explore dysautonomia in aging individuals, it’s important to consider how this condition interacts with other age-related health issues. This understanding can help healthcare providers, caregivers, and patients themselves develop more effective strategies for managing symptoms and improving quality of life.

What is Dysautonomia?

Dysautonomia is a complex group of medical disorders that arise from problems with the autonomic nervous system (ANS). The ANS plays a crucial role in maintaining the body’s balance, or homeostasis, by regulating functions such as heart rate, blood pressure, digestion, and body temperature. When the ANS malfunctions or fails, it results in a condition known as dysautonomia. This condition is more common than many people realize, affecting over 70 million individuals worldwide across all demographics, including different genders, races, and ages.

Types of Dysautonomia

There are approximately 15 different types of dysautonomia, and it’s possible for a person to have multiple types simultaneously. Some of the most common types include:

  • Postural Orthostatic Tachycardia Syndrome (POTS): POTS is one of the more frequently diagnosed forms of dysautonomia. People with POTS experience an abnormal increase in heart rate when standing up. They may also feel dizzy, weak, and lightheaded. Other symptoms can include shortness of breath, chest pain, heart palpitations, tremors, extreme fatigue, headaches, difficulty sleeping, and challenges with exercise.

  • Orthostatic Hypotension (OH): OH occurs when the body struggles to regulate blood pressure upon standing. Individuals with OH may experience sudden dizziness or lightheadedness when they stand up. They might also feel fatigued, have blurry vision, or experience brain fog. Some people report nausea, headaches, weakness, heart palpitations, shortness of breath, or pain in the chest, neck, or shoulders.

  • Noncardiogenic/Vasovagal Syncope (VVS): VVS causes fainting episodes due to a sudden drop in blood pressure and heart rate. Before fainting, a person might experience clamminess, excessive sweating, nausea, or a feeling of warmth or flushing. They may also notice changes in their hearing, become pale, or experience graying or loss of vision.

  • Inappropriate Sinus Tachycardia (IST): IST is characterized by an abnormally high resting heart rate, typically above 100 beats per minute, without an apparent cause. People with IST often experience heart palpitations, extreme fatigue, dizziness, weakness, shortness of breath, and occasionally fainting.

  • Autoimmune Autonomic Ganglionopathy (AAG): AAG is a rare form of dysautonomia that often leads to orthostatic hypotension. Symptoms can include dry mouth or eyes, problems with bladder function, burning or prickling sensations in the arms or legs, a condition called Adie’s pupil (where one pupil is larger than the other), and various other neurological symptoms.

Causes and Risk Factors of Dysautonomia

The causes of dysautonomia can vary widely, making it a challenging condition to diagnose and treat. Some potential causes include:

  1. Genetic mutations: Certain inherited genetic variations can increase the risk of developing dysautonomia.

  2. Autoimmune disorders: Conditions where the immune system attacks the body’s own tissues can sometimes lead to dysautonomia.

  3. Infections: Some viral or bacterial infections may trigger the onset of dysautonomia symptoms.

  4. Medications: Certain medications can interfere with the autonomic nervous system and potentially cause dysautonomia.

Recent research has also highlighted a connection between long COVID and dysautonomia. Studies have shown that people experiencing long-term effects from COVID-19 have a higher risk of developing dysautonomia, with one study finding it in nearly 70% of long COVID patients.

Other medical conditions that can contribute to the development of dysautonomia include Parkinson’s disease, multiple system atrophy, and diabetes. These conditions can affect the nervous system in ways that may lead to autonomic dysfunction.

The Impact of Aging on Dysautonomia

Physiological Changes in Aging and Their Effects on Dysautonomia

As people get older, their bodies go through many changes that can make dysautonomia worse. The autonomic nervous system, which controls automatic body functions like heart rate and blood pressure, becomes less effective with age. This decline can lead to various problems for older adults with dysautonomia.

One important change is the decrease in baroreflex sensitivity. The baroreflex helps keep blood pressure steady when we stand up or change positions. As this reflex weakens, older adults may experience sudden drops in blood pressure when they stand, a condition called orthostatic hypotension. This can make them feel dizzy or even faint.

Another age-related change is the reduced ability of blood vessels to constrict and dilate. This makes it harder for the body to adjust blood flow to different parts of the body as needed. For people with dysautonomia, this can worsen symptoms like poor circulation or heat intolerance.

The heart also undergoes changes with age. It may become less responsive to signals from the autonomic nervous system, leading to problems with heart rate variability. This can affect how well the heart adapts to different situations, such as exercise or stress.

Increased Prevalence of Dysautonomia in Older Adults

Dysautonomia becomes more common as people age. This is partly because of the natural changes in the autonomic nervous system, but also because older adults are more likely to have other health problems that can cause or worsen dysautonomia.

For example, conditions like diabetes and high blood pressure, which are more common in older adults, can damage the autonomic nerves over time. This damage can lead to various forms of dysautonomia. Some types of dysautonomia, such as multiple system atrophy and pure autonomic failure, are almost exclusively seen in older adults.

Older adults are also more likely to take multiple medications, some of which can affect the autonomic nervous system. This can either cause new autonomic symptoms or make existing dysautonomia worse.

Age-Related Complications and Co-Morbidities

When older adults have dysautonomia, they often face additional challenges due to age-related complications and other health conditions. These issues can make dysautonomia symptoms worse and harder to manage.

One major concern is the increased risk of falls. Orthostatic hypotension, which is common in older adults with dysautonomia, can cause dizziness and fainting when standing up. This greatly increases the risk of falling, which can lead to serious injuries like hip fractures.

Older adults with dysautonomia may also have trouble regulating their body temperature. This can make them more susceptible to heat exhaustion in hot weather or hypothermia in cold conditions. They may need extra help staying comfortable in different environments.

Bladder and bowel problems are another common issue. Dysautonomia can affect the nerves that control these functions, leading to incontinence or constipation. These problems can be especially troublesome for older adults who may already have reduced mobility.

Many older adults with dysautonomia also have other neurological conditions like Parkinson’s disease or dementia with Lewy bodies. These conditions can have overlapping symptoms with dysautonomia, making diagnosis and treatment more complicated. Doctors need to carefully consider all of a patient’s health issues when planning care for dysautonomia in older adults.

Unique Challenges in Diagnosing Dysautonomia in Older Adults

Diagnosing dysautonomia in older adults presents several unique challenges. These difficulties arise primarily due to the overlap of symptoms with age-related changes and other co-existing medical conditions. As a result, healthcare providers must be especially vigilant and thorough in their approach to diagnosis.

Difficulty in Distinguishing Dysautonomia Symptoms from Age-Related Changes

One of the main challenges in diagnosing dysautonomia in older adults is the similarity between its symptoms and common age-related changes. Many symptoms of dysautonomia, such as fatigue, dizziness, and shortness of breath, are also frequently experienced by older adults as part of the normal aging process. This overlap can lead to misdiagnosis or delayed diagnosis of dysautonomia.

For example, an older adult experiencing frequent dizzy spells might attribute this to normal aging, when it could actually be a sign of orthostatic hypotension, a form of dysautonomia. Similarly, increased fatigue might be dismissed as a natural part of getting older, rather than recognized as a potential symptom of autonomic dysfunction.

To further complicate matters, older adults often have multiple health conditions, known as comorbidities. These conditions can mask or mimic symptoms of dysautonomia, making it even more challenging to identify the underlying autonomic dysfunction.

Importance of Comprehensive Medical History and Physical Examination

Given these challenges, a thorough medical history and physical examination are crucial in diagnosing dysautonomia in older adults. Healthcare providers should take extra care to gather detailed information about the patient’s symptoms, including:

  • When the symptoms first appeared
  • How often they occur
  • What seems to trigger or worsen the symptoms
  • How the symptoms impact daily life and activities

It’s also important to review the patient’s current medications, as some drugs can cause side effects that mimic dysautonomia symptoms.

The physical examination should be comprehensive, focusing on various body systems affected by the autonomic nervous system. This includes:

  • Cardiovascular system: Checking for changes in heart rate and blood pressure in different positions
  • Urinary system: Assessing for signs of bladder dysfunction
  • Neurological system: Evaluating reflexes and sensory function
  • Sudomotor function: Checking for abnormalities in sweating

Role of Diagnostic Tests

While a thorough history and physical exam are essential, diagnostic tests play a crucial role in confirming dysautonomia in older adults. These tests provide objective data to support the diagnosis and can help rule out other conditions. Some common diagnostic tests include:

  1. Heart Rate Variability (HRV) Test: This test measures the variation in time between heartbeats. Reduced heart rate variability can indicate autonomic dysfunction. The test is non-invasive and can be performed over 24 hours using a portable monitor.

  2. Tilt Table Test: This test helps diagnose conditions like Postural Orthostatic Tachycardia Syndrome (POTS) and Orthostatic Hypotension (OH). During the test, the patient is strapped to a table that tilts from a lying to standing position while their heart rate and blood pressure are monitored.

  3. Blood Pressure Monitoring: Continuous blood pressure monitoring over 24 hours can help identify patterns consistent with dysautonomia, such as sudden drops in blood pressure upon standing or after meals.

  4. Electrocardiogram (ECG): This test records the electrical activity of the heart and can detect rhythm abnormalities associated with dysautonomia. It’s particularly useful in identifying heart rate irregularities that may not be apparent during a routine physical exam.

  5. Quantitative Sudomotor Axon Reflex Test (QSART): This test evaluates the function of small nerve fibers that control sweating. It can help diagnose conditions like neuropathy that may be causing autonomic dysfunction.

By combining these diagnostic tests with a comprehensive medical history and physical examination, healthcare providers can more accurately diagnose dysautonomia in older adults, leading to better management and improved quality of life.

Management and Treatment of Dysautonomia in Older Adults

Managing dysautonomia in older adults requires a carefully planned approach that combines various strategies to address the unique challenges faced by this age group. The treatment plan typically includes lifestyle modifications, medication-based interventions, and alternative therapies. Each of these components plays a crucial role in managing symptoms and improving overall quality of life for older adults with dysautonomia.

Lifestyle Modifications

Making changes to daily habits and routines can significantly improve symptoms of dysautonomia in older adults. Here are some key lifestyle modifications that can be beneficial:

  • Exercise: Regular physical activity is essential for managing dysautonomia. Older adults should aim to engage in gentle exercises that are appropriate for their fitness level. Swimming is an excellent low-impact option that can help improve cardiovascular function without putting too much strain on the joints. Yoga is another great choice, as it combines gentle movement with breathing exercises, which can help regulate the autonomic nervous system. It’s important to start slowly and gradually increase the intensity and duration of exercise under the guidance of a healthcare professional.

  • Diet: A well-balanced diet plays a crucial role in managing dysautonomia symptoms. Older adults with this condition often benefit from increasing their salt intake, as it can help maintain blood volume and improve blood pressure regulation. However, this should only be done under medical supervision, especially for those with heart or kidney issues. Staying well-hydrated is also important, so drinking plenty of water throughout the day is recommended. Eating small, frequent meals can help prevent large drops in blood pressure after eating.

  • Stress Management: Stress can worsen dysautonomia symptoms, so learning to manage stress effectively is crucial. Older adults can try various relaxation techniques such as deep breathing exercises, meditation, or gentle stretching. These practices can help calm the nervous system and reduce the frequency and severity of symptom flare-ups. It’s also important to prioritize good sleep habits and maintain a consistent sleep schedule.

Pharmacological Interventions

Medications can be an important part of managing dysautonomia in older adults. However, it’s crucial to consider potential side effects and drug interactions, especially in this age group. Here are some common medications used:

  • Beta Blockers: These medications work by slowing down the heart rate and can be particularly helpful for older adults with postural orthostatic tachycardia syndrome (POTS) or inappropriate sinus tachycardia (IST). They can help reduce symptoms such as rapid heartbeat and dizziness. However, they should be used cautiously in older adults with asthma or certain heart conditions.

  • Fludrocortisone: This medication helps the body retain more salt and water, which can increase blood volume. This can be beneficial for older adults with orthostatic hypotension (OH), as it can help maintain blood pressure when standing up. However, it’s important to monitor for potential side effects such as swelling or electrolyte imbalances.

  • Midodrine: This medication works by constricting blood vessels, which can help increase blood pressure. It can be particularly useful for older adults with OH who experience frequent dizzy spells or fainting. However, it’s important to take this medication at specific times of the day to avoid high blood pressure while lying down.

Alternative Therapies

Alternative therapies can complement traditional treatments and may provide additional relief for some older adults with dysautonomia. These therapies include:

  • Acupuncture: This traditional Chinese medicine technique involves inserting thin needles into specific points on the body. Some older adults with dysautonomia find that acupuncture helps improve their symptoms, possibly by promoting better autonomic nervous system function. It’s important to choose a licensed practitioner who has experience working with older adults and understands the complexities of dysautonomia.

  • Yoga: While also mentioned under exercise, yoga deserves special attention as an alternative therapy. In addition to its physical benefits, yoga incorporates mindfulness and breathing techniques that can be particularly helpful for managing dysautonomia symptoms. Gentle or chair yoga classes designed for older adults can be a good starting point.

  • Physical Therapy: Working with a physical therapist can be extremely beneficial for older adults with dysautonomia. A therapist can design a personalized exercise program that focuses on improving strength, balance, and cardiovascular function. They can also teach techniques for safely changing positions to minimize symptoms like dizziness. Physical therapy can help reduce the risk of falls, which is particularly important for older adults with dysautonomia who may be prone to dizziness or fainting.

Considerations for Healthcare Providers

Healthcare providers play a crucial role in managing dysautonomia in older adults. Several considerations are essential for effective care and support for this unique patient population.

Importance of Interdisciplinary Care Teams

Interdisciplinary care teams are vital for managing the complex needs of older adults with dysautonomia. These teams typically include:

  • Cardiologists to monitor heart function and manage cardiovascular symptoms
  • Neurologists to address nervous system issues and neurological symptoms
  • Physical therapists to help improve mobility and balance
  • Occupational therapists to assist with daily living activities
  • Nutritionists to provide guidance on diet and hydration
  • Mental health professionals to support emotional well-being

By working together, these specialists can provide comprehensive care that addresses all aspects of dysautonomia in older adults. Regular team meetings and care coordination ensure that treatment plans are tailored to each patient’s specific needs and adjusted as their condition changes over time.

Addressing Age-Related Barriers to Care

Older adults often face unique challenges that can make it difficult to access healthcare services. Some common barriers include:

  • Transportation issues: Many older adults may no longer drive or have limited access to public transportation.
  • Cognitive impairment: Memory problems or confusion can make it hard to follow treatment plans or remember appointments.
  • Physical limitations: Mobility issues can make it challenging to attend in-person appointments.
  • Social isolation: Lack of support from family or friends can impact care management.

To address these barriers, healthcare providers can:

  • Offer flexible appointment times to accommodate transportation schedules
  • Provide home visits or telemedicine options for patients with mobility issues
  • Use clear, simple language and written instructions to support patients with cognitive impairment
  • Involve family members or caregivers in the care process when appropriate
  • Connect patients with community resources and support services

By taking these steps, healthcare providers can help ensure that older adults with dysautonomia receive the care they need, despite age-related challenges.

Patient Education and Empowerment Strategies

Educating patients about their condition is crucial for effective management of dysautonomia in older adults. Healthcare providers should focus on:

  • Explaining dysautonomia in simple terms, including its causes, symptoms, and potential complications
  • Discussing treatment options and their benefits and risks
  • Teaching self-management techniques, such as proper hydration, exercise, and symptom tracking
  • Providing information on lifestyle modifications that can help manage symptoms
  • Offering resources for further learning, such as support groups or reputable websites

To empower patients, healthcare providers can:

  • Encourage patients to ask questions and voice concerns during appointments
  • Involve patients in decision-making about their treatment plans
  • Teach patients how to recognize and respond to changes in their symptoms
  • Provide tools for tracking symptoms and medication effects
  • Offer regular follow-up appointments to assess progress and adjust treatment as needed

By focusing on patient education and empowerment, healthcare providers can help older adults with dysautonomia take an active role in their care, leading to better treatment adherence and improved quality of life.

Future Directions and Research Opportunities

Emerging Areas of Research in Dysautonomia and Aging

Research in dysautonomia and aging is advancing rapidly, with scientists exploring several exciting new areas. One key focus is understanding how autonomic dysfunction affects cognitive decline in older adults. Researchers are investigating the link between poor blood pressure regulation and the development of dementia. They are also studying how dysautonomia might contribute to falls and mobility issues in the elderly. Another important area of study is the impact of dysautonomia on sleep patterns and overall quality of life in aging populations. Scientists are using advanced imaging techniques to map changes in the autonomic nervous system as people age, hoping to identify early warning signs of dysautonomia.

Potential Therapeutic Targets and Interventions

Future treatments for dysautonomia in older adults may target specific parts of the autonomic nervous system. Researchers are developing medications that can selectively activate or inhibit certain autonomic functions. For example, drugs that improve heart rate variability are being tested to help manage symptoms like dizziness and fainting. Scientists are also exploring the use of electrical stimulation devices to regulate autonomic function. These devices might be implanted or used externally to help control blood pressure and other autonomic responses. Non-drug treatments are gaining attention too. Researchers are studying how exercises like tai chi and yoga can improve balance and reduce falls in older adults with dysautonomia. They are also investigating the benefits of special diets and supplements in managing symptoms.

Conclusion

Dysautonomia in aging individuals presents a complex set of challenges that require careful consideration and management. As people grow older, their bodies undergo numerous changes that can affect the autonomic nervous system. These changes can make dysautonomia symptoms more pronounced and difficult to manage in older adults.

The increased prevalence of dysautonomia among aging populations highlights the need for greater awareness among healthcare providers. Doctors and nurses should be trained to recognize the signs and symptoms of dysautonomia in older patients, as they may be easily mistaken for other age-related conditions.

Age-related complications can make dysautonomia more challenging to treat in older adults. For example, older individuals may have multiple health conditions that interact with dysautonomia, making diagnosis and treatment more complex. Additionally, older adults may be more sensitive to medications, requiring careful adjustment of dosages and close monitoring for side effects.

To effectively care for aging individuals with dysautonomia, healthcare providers should adopt a comprehensive approach. This means looking at the whole person, not just their symptoms. Doctors should consider how dysautonomia affects their patient’s daily life, mental health, and overall well-being.

A multifaceted approach to managing dysautonomia in older adults is crucial. This includes:

  1. Lifestyle modifications: Encouraging patients to make changes to their diet, exercise routines, and sleep habits can help manage symptoms. For instance, increasing fluid and salt intake can help with blood pressure regulation.

  2. Pharmacological interventions: Medications can be used to address specific symptoms of dysautonomia. However, it’s important to carefully consider potential drug interactions and side effects in older adults.

  3. Alternative therapies: Some patients may benefit from non-traditional treatments such as acupuncture, biofeedback, or yoga. These therapies can complement conventional treatments and help manage stress, which often worsens dysautonomia symptoms.

  4. Regular monitoring: Frequent check-ups and adjustments to treatment plans are essential as the condition and the patient’s overall health may change over time.

  5. Patient education: Helping older adults understand their condition and how to manage it can improve their quality of life and reduce anxiety about their symptoms.

As our population continues to age, more research is needed to better understand and treat dysautonomia in older adults. Collaboration between specialists in neurology, cardiology, geriatrics, and other relevant fields will be crucial in developing new and more effective treatment strategies.

By focusing on these areas and continuing to improve our understanding of dysautonomia in aging individuals, healthcare providers can offer better care and support to this vulnerable population. This approach can help older adults with dysautonomia maintain their independence and quality of life for as long as possible.
